Four Grades, One Material: The Pure Nickel Family

This page covers commercial pure nickel wire — Ni200 (UNS N02200), Ni201 (UNS N02201), N4 (NP1) and N6 (NP2). These are purity designations, not alloy grades: pure nickel carries no deliberate alloy additions, which is why the shorthand "200" and "201" should be written as Ni200 and Ni201 to avoid confusion with alloy numbering systems. The face-centered cubic lattice is shared by all four grades and is the reason forming, welding and magnetic behaviour stay consistent across the matrix.

How the FCC Lattice Shapes Wire Behaviour

Nickel crystallizes in a face-centered cubic (FCC) lattice, and the structure sets the wire's shop-floor behaviour: multiple slip systems allow uniform plastic deformation, so the wire bends, coils and forms without cracking, and weld joints stay consistent along the spool. The FCC lattice is also the basis of the ferromagnetic response that matters in motors, transformers and magnetic sensors — nickel is ferromagnetic up to its Curie point of 358°C.

Corrosion in Service: Media, Temperature and Grade

Pure nickel resists corrosion in reducing media, alkalis and many organic environments, and holds up to oxidation in moderate-temperature service — the combination that puts it in chemical processing equipment, aerospace components and battery assemblies. Resistance is inherent to the metal rather than to a surface treatment, so cut ends and weld zones keep the same profile as the as-drawn surface. Confirm the operating media, temperature and concentration against your process before ordering; the mill certificate records the actual lot composition.

Four Grades, One Wire: Ni200 vs Ni201 vs N4 vs N6

All four grades sit in the pure nickel series, and each is selected against the service media and price target. N4 (≥99.9% Ni+Co) serves the most demanding purity and research duties; N6 (≥99.5%) covers general industrial use; Ni201 (≥99.0%, C ≤0.02%) suits low-carbon, welding-sensitive applications; Ni200 (≥99.2%, C ≤0.15%) is the standard mechanical and electrical grade. Because purity, carbon limit and price move together, the grade is chosen against the application — not by habit.

Chemical Composition

GradeNi (min)C (max)
N499.9% (Ni+Co)0.01%
N699.5% (Ni+Co)0.1%
Ni200 (UNS N02200)99.2%0.15%
Ni201 (UNS N02201)99.0%0.02%

Mechanical & Physical Properties

Annealed wire: tensile strength ≥462 MPa, elongation ≥35%, hardness 90-120 HB. Physical constants: density 8.908 g/cm³, melting point 1435-1446°C, boiling point 2732°C, Curie point 358°C (ferromagnetic below), electrical resistivity 0.096 μΩ·m, thermal conductivity (Ni200) 70.2 W/m·K.

Applicable Standards

Ni200/Ni201: ASTM B164 (Nickel Rod, Bar and Wire). N4/N6: GB/T 21653 (Nickel and Nickel Alloy Wire and Drawn Wire Stock). Export documentation per EN 10204 3.1.
